#A98519 Color
#A98519 is rgb(169, 133, 25) in RGB, hsl(45, 74%, 38%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 21%, 85%, 34%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Goldenrod (#B8860B),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.29.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#A98519 Channel Values
How #A98519 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 169 · G 133 · B 25 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 45° · S 74% · L 38%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 45° · S 85% · V 66%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 21% · Y 85% · K 34%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.47:1 vs white · 6.06: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#A98519 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#A98519?
#A98519 is a dark yellow — rgb(169, 133, 25) in RGB and hsl(45, 74%, 38%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Goldenrod (#B8860B),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.29.
What is the RGB value of #A98519?
#A98519 is rgb(169, 133, 25) — red 169, green 133, and blue 25 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#A98519?
#A98519 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 21%, 85%, 34%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#A98519 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#A98519 scores 3.47:1 against white and 6.06: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#A98519 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#A98519 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kgoldenrod (#B8860B) at a CIE76 distance of 8.29,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
